How To Root Galaxy C9 Pro On Nougat 7.1.1 Using CF AutoRoot? (All Models)

Image Credits:  Samsung Electronics

Today we are going to root the selfie expert Samsung Galaxy Galaxy C9 Pro (all models) running on Android Nougat 7.1.1 Using the popular CF AutoRoot method.

The Samsung Galaxy Galaxy C9 Pro with 6 GB RAM comes with a 16 MP rear and front camera (yes you heard it right, both cameras are 16MP), 4000 mAh battery and 6.0 inches Super AMOLED capacitive touchscreen display having Corning Gorilla Glass protection.

This method is compatible on all Samsung Galaxy C9 Pro models like Galaxy C9 Pro SM-C9000, Galaxy C9 Pro SM-C9008, Galaxy C9 Pro SM-C900F and Galaxy C9 Pro SM-C900Y.

Please note that you need to take a backup of your complete files on your phone memory, just a precaution for worst case scenario. Also please keep in mind that the rooting will void your warranty. SamsungSFour.com is not liable for any damage caused as a result of this tutorial.

Steps To Root Samsung Galaxy Galaxy C9 Pro (All Models) running on Android Nougat 7.1.1 using CF AutoRoot

1. To start with please download the necessary files from the below given links (If there is any issue with the download link please report us using the comment option at the end of this tutorial).

2. Once downloaded please extract it to your PC desktop. You can check the below screenshot to get an idea on the extracted contents.

3. Now enable 'USB debugging mode" on your phone. Please follow the below tutorial to enable USB Debugging.

4. Once done please switch of your phone and enter it into "Download mode".

To enter into download mode press and hold the"Vol Down"+"Home"+"Power" buttons at the same time until you see the warning screen. When you get the warning screen please press "Vol up" to continue and enter into the download mode.

You may also try the below given download mode tutorials for detailed instruction on entering into the download mode.

Once done please instal the Samsung USB drivers for your phone (please google for the drivers) and install it if not already done.

5. Now open the "image" folder (from the earlier downloaded files) and you will see a file named "image.tar.md5" like shown in the screenshot below.

6. Now go back to the main folder and you will see contents like in the below screenshot.

7. Once you are in the main folder please open the "tools" folder and run the "Odin.exe" file from there.

Double click the file to run it and you will get the Odin application opened as shown in the screenshot below. Now connect your phone using the USB data cable to your PC. If the connection was successful you will get an added message in the "Odin" app.

Now click the "AP" button and select the "image.tar.md5" file you found in the "image" folder (mentioned in step no: 5). When done please click the "Start" button in the Odin app to initiate the rooting process.

Once the rooting process starts it will do the rest by it's own without any user input and once it's done the Galaxy C9 Pro will restart and you will get a "Pass" message in the Odin app.
